Miltonduff 28 Year Old 1988 - Single Cask (Master of Malt)
28-year-old single malt from the marvellous Miltonduff folks, aged in a single bourbon hogshead and bottled by our fair hands for our Single Cask Series! This was distilled in October 1988 and bottled in April 2017 with no chill-filtration or additional colours, presented at cask strength.
Tasting Note by The Chaps at Master of Malt
Nose
Lots of fruit: apple strudel, Kelloggs Fruit & Nut cereal, pineapple and grapefruit. It’s also quite green, with aromas of freshly cut grass, moss and a handful of herbs. Chuck in some Bakewell Tarts for good measure, too.
Palate
It’s really quite hoppy with a pleasingly soft mouthfeel lifted by a little fresh chilli prickle. There’s also orchard fruits, cashew nuts, a mineral quality and the impression of menthol.
Finish
Soft and gentle with more orchard fruits, pepped up with the chilli warmth.
Overall
A lovely autumnal dram.
